Brake Fluid Flush, Now Not Bleeding?

  1. #1
    Got a 16v, I flushed out all my old brake fluid yesterday and removed all my calipers and stripped them down etc, now I've fitted it all back and also fitted a GTi6 master cylinder the brakes don't want to seem to bleed at all, i've started to fill the reservoir up and its just sitting at maximum even with a bleed nipple open and me pumping the pedal.

    Just to clarify I drained all of the fluid out of the system.

    A mate of mine drained his recently, he then opened up both rear bleed nipples (with tubing into bottles on them) and left for about 30-40 minutes topping up master cylinder as reqd, he said it worked a treat. Then he went round and bled all brakes afterwards to get rest of air out

    Could be airlocked or stuck bleed nipples? I remember a 106 I was bleeding up a while back - caliper piston would not push back in and it ended up bending a 12 inch g clamp out of shape. The fix was to take the bleed nipple right out as it was clogged up, let the air and old fluid out and it worked a treat

    My fluid isn't getting past the master cylinder though that's the problem. And there is no fluid in the system whatsoever

    Master cylinder was blocked. Took it off and pumped it by hand and it fixed it. Now bleeding fine. Thread can be closed.
